Sat 1332010417190645

decimal
322804.417190645
degree
0°112804′244″417190645‴
percentile
63.42906755504082%
name
ekkpltvwwrs
cycle
0
epoch
1
period
160
block
322804
offset
417190645
timestamp
rarity
common